The Trace Elliot 3620100 Transformer DI Pedal is an essential tool for any musician looking to optimize their sound, both on stage and in the studio. This versatile device acts as an interface between an electric instrument and a PA system or recording console, delivering unparalleled tonal clarity and authenticity.
At its core, the 3620100 Transformer DI Pedal is a transformer isolation unit. It employs a custom-wound, high-performance toroidal transformer to ensure a pure signal path. This transformer effectively eliminates the electrical interference that can degrade the tone and cause unwanted artifacts when sending a signal from an instrument directly to a PA system or recording console.
The pedal is designed with a user-friendly interface, featuring a single input for connecting your instrument, a ground lift switch, and two outputs for sending the signal to separate destinations, such as a PA system and a recording console. This allows for seamless integration of your sound into various live and studio environments.
The 3620100 Transformer DI Pedal is not only useful for eliminating interference but also serves to enhance the tone of your instrument. The custom-designed transformer imparts a subtle yet noticeable improvement to the low end, adding depth and warmth to your sound.
Constructed with high-quality components and robust build, the Trace Elliot 3620100 Transformer DI Pedal is built to withstand the rigors of live performances and studio sessions. The durable metal housing ensures that the pedal remains protected, while the compact design makes it easy to transport and integrate into your existing setup.
